Travis Kelce Gives His First Response to Taylor Swift’s New Album

It’s been a big day for Taylor Swift, who released her much-anticipated new album, “Life of a Showgirl,” on Friday, October 3. As expected, some of the songs on the album are about her soon-to-be-husband Travis Kelce of the Kansas City Chiefs, so it’s extra fun for Chiefs Kingdom to listen to the set.

So far, Kelce has been pretty tight-lipped about his thoughts on the album, but he’s finally made a public move that shows that, yes, he approves. It would be pretty wild for Kelce to not like this album, since he has said that he was a fan of Swift’s music before they were even an item, so it’s not a surprise that he’s being supportive of the set. Plus, Swift even gave listeners their first deep looking into the album on Kelce’s “New Heights” podcast back in August.

Kelce made a move on Friday that showed his support for Swift and “Life of a Showgirl,” and it was for the world to see.


Travis Kelce Supports Taylor Swift’s ‘Life of a Showgirl’ in a Small Way

On Friday, rapper 50 Cent heard Swift’s new album and was super happy to have his name dropped in it on the song “Ruin the Friendship.” He took to Instagram to announce the news, and he gave his own shout-out to Swift.

In a post, he said that Swift’s music was “popping right now” and that “she shout me out.” He added, “She don’t shout you out” and that it was for “big timers only.” He also seemed pumped that he’s the “only shout out on the whole album.”

The rapper also said in a different post that he’s a “low-key Swiftie” and urged people to check out the album, saying, “I like this album, check it out.” So, she has a fan in 50 Cent.

Kelce saw the post and liked it on Instagram, as captured by Elle. The magazine added that it was his first public reaction to the new album from Swift. It probably won’t be too much longer until Kelce says more about what he likes about this record.


Taylor Swift’s Secret to Success

So, how did Swift become such a global superstar? In a piece out on Friday, October 3, in CNBC, Sinéad O’Sullivan says it’s because she uses the “drip” method for releasing music. This method involves releasing songs and special releases here and there instead of all at once, and a lot of musicians use it today, including yours truly.

“Traditional entertainment was built on the ‘big drop,’” she notes in the piece. “An artist worked for years on an album, released it, and hoped the hype lasted. In many ways, Swift rewrote that playbook.”

Instead, Swift releases a bunch of material, in addition to her albums. She doesn’t just drop everything at once and then go away.

O’Sullivan notes that over the past five years, Swift has “released nine studio albums, including re-recordings of her back catalog, put out a concert film, and went on a global, record-breaking tour. Each project creates its own wave of attention and, crucially, points to the next. Fans never feel the silence between cycles.”

So, Swift stays in the public eye, and people like it that way. She’ll also stay in the public eye at Chiefs games this season.
